Posted Tuesday 22nd January 2008 14:03 GMT
The only way to prevent this with ISP gateways is...
projects like http://www.neufbox4.org which aims at creating an alternative and entirely open firmware for the gateway
ISPs usually break the GPL by using free software and not redistributing, and their gateways rely on security by obscurity.
The customer is then dependent on the firmware upgrade from the ISP following the discovery of a vulnerability, and some times it can take ages before it is corrected.
When the community is in charge of an alternative firmware, vulnerabilities are spotted earlier and corrected faster.